> Many of the build peers have long review queues. I'm not convinced
> that all of the review requests going to any particular build peer
> need to be exclusive. We're going to try an experiment to see if we
> can make this better for patch authors and reviewers alike. To this
> end, we've set up a shared review queue for patches submitted to the
> Core::Build Config module.
>
> How to participate:
>
> When you submit your next Build Config patch, simply select the new,
> shared "user" core-build-config-revi...@mozilla.bugs as the reviewer
> instead of a specific build peer. The build peers are watching this
> new user, and will triage and review your patch accordingly.
>
> This new arrangement should hopefully shorten patch queues for
> specific reviewers and improve turnaround times for everybody. It also
> has the added benefit of automatically working around absences,
> vacations, and departures of build peers.
>
> Note: this system still allows for targeting reviews to specific build
> peers. Indeed, the build peers may do exactly that in triage if the
> patch in question touches a particular sub-domain. However, I would
> encourage patch authors to use the shared bucket unless you really
> understand the sub-domain yourself or are collaborating directly with
> a particular build peer.
>
> As indicated in the subject, this is an experiment. I will monitor
> patch queues and turnaround time over the next few months, and then
> decide in January whether we should continue or try something else.
